The latest publication from The Smith Family is here! The Pathways, Engagement, and Transitions (PET) study, aims to understand the post-school pathways of young people facing disadvantage. The third PET report focusses on the experiences and pathways of early school leavers, with the research identifying several opportunities to provide targeted support to help more young people complete Year 12. Over three years (2021-2023), the PET study gathered firsthand experiences from young people experiencing disadvantage. These individuals, part of The Smith Family's long-term educational scholarship program, Learning for Life, were in Year 10 or Year 12 in late 2020.
